Subject: [PATCH v7 00/10] netfilter: ipset fixes
Date: Thu, 14 May 2026 10:55:09 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20260514085519.12729-1-kadlec@netfilter.org> (raw)
Hi Pablo,
Here follows the new revision of the fixes for the current list
of ipset related issues. Let's see what else is lurking.
Best regards,
Jozsef
Jozsef Kadlecsik (10):
netfilter: ipset: fix a potential dump-destroy race
netfilter: ipset: Fix data race between add and list header in all
hash types
netfilter: ipset: Fix data race between add and dump in all hash types
netfilter: ipset: annotate "pos" for concurrent readers/writers
netfilter: ipset: Don't use test_bit() in lockless RCU readers in hash
types
netfilter: ipset: Don't use test_bit() in lockless RCU readers in
bitmap types
netfilter: ipset: fix order of kfree_rcu() and rcu_assign_pointer()
netfilter: ipset: skip gc when resize is in progress
netfilter: ipset: fix potential torn read in reuse/forceadd cases
netfilter: ipset: add comment how cidr bookkeeping is working
net/netfilter/ipset/ip_set_bitmap_gen.h | 7 +-
net/netfilter/ipset/ip_set_core.c | 9 +-
net/netfilter/ipset/ip_set_hash_gen.h | 125 ++++++++++++++++--------
3 files changed, 94 insertions(+), 47 deletions(-)
